Output 85e96b07f864b310ad580794e5647137b649d9cd40f79d5589339abca58ba064:0

value
50285568811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16e96e1f0e50863b24825b8f18f3a5860ed5e923 OP_EQUALVERIFY OP_CHECKSIG
address
1369WEUBudNBxgzBpfDD6iDHmgDjZNe6iR
transaction
85e96b07f864b310ad580794e5647137b649d9cd40f79d5589339abca58ba064
confirmations
550035
spent
true